Hi — handing off the Fernwhistle feed validator to you. It checks podcast feeds nightly: enclosure reachability, episode GUID uniqueness, artwork dimensions. The strict mode flag trips a lot of false positives on older feeds, so we keep it relaxed for anything pre-2019. Flaky hosts get three retries before we flag them. Ping Orla if the queue backs up. Here's what it's currently running with:

config for kafof-bawef:
holath:
  log_level: debug
  metrics_host: metrics.holath.qorvelsys.internal
  pin: 2191
  pool_size: 32

Cold starts on the Wrenfall serverless handlers are owned by the Runtime Efficiency group, not the feature teams. They manage the pre-warm scheduler, memory tier settings, and the latency budget dashboards. Before filing anything, confirm the slowness happens on first invocation only and note the handler name and region. For cold start regressions, pre-warm config changes, or dashboard access, contact the group here.

escalation mailbox, yajeg-bageg: quenax.olidor@lumiccorp.internal

Action item from the Marrowfield tile-rendering incident: the cache layer served stale tiles for six hours because invalidation messages were dropped silently when the Hollowbrook queue hit its retention limit. Support should now treat any report of outdated map imagery as a possible cache-invalidation failure rather than a renderer bug. Check the invalidation lag metric first, and only escalate to the rendering team if lag is under two minutes. The verification steps and the escalation threshold table are kept on the page below.

runbook for tafof-yawif: https://confluence.tolvaqsys.internal/display/display/browse/pages/7be3

Onboarding: the Larkspur occupancy feed polls garage controllers in the Tidmouth district every 30 seconds and publishes counts to the availability topic. Consumers should treat gaps under two minutes as normal controller jitter. Local development runs against the simulator, but staging and production connect to the live broker, which requires authentication. After cloning the repo and copying the env template, complete your setup by adding the following line to your env file.

secret setting of yajog-taguf: ARCHIVE_KEY3=051